Output 23c17cdbac8d31344c9d9f349db40863005e2bb22df54f7db0744df014f3f89b:0

value
1035538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2898ca7066f6139c0921f73b4af12ae13a85668d OP_EQUAL
address
MBbpJC8eoqGZ5T2457dh9TUeLPq25AEoUX
transaction
23c17cdbac8d31344c9d9f349db40863005e2bb22df54f7db0744df014f3f89b
spent
true